The Vice Chancellor, Obafemi Awowolo University, Ile Ife, Prof. Bamitale Omole, yesterday said the university would no longer offer automatic employment to graduates who make First Class degree.

Omole was addressing journalists in Ile Ife at a news conference to mark the 41st convocation ceremony of the institution.

He said graduates who make First Class should forget about automatic employment as there is no more vacancy as a result of the current economic situation in the country.

He noted that the idea of giving automatic employment to First Class graduates by the university was designed in the 1980s to retain them because they were not always willing to remain in the academics.

"The truth is that our First Class graduates should forget about automatic employment considering the dwindling resources and given the large number of students who obtain first class grade now. It is no longer possible for us to offer them automatic employment," he said
